Shadow and Bone (TV Series)

TV Series. Fantasy TV Series (2021-2023). 2 Seasons. 16 Episodes. In a world cleaved in two by a massive barrier of perpetual darkness, a young soldier uncovers a power that might finally unite her country. But as she struggles to hone her power, dangerous forces plot against her. Thugs, thieves, assassins and saints are at war now, and it will take more than magic to survive.

Canceled after its second season.
